Cryptocurrency trading platform BitMEX has announced an extension of its agreement with Italian professional football club AC Milan. As per the agreement, BitMEX will continue to act as a Premier Partner and the Official Cryptocurrency Trading Partner of the club.
The two parties began their partnership in 2021, and BitMEX served as the club’s sleeve partner for the 2021/22 season.
The new partnership will aim at improving the brand’s presence while providing fans with several benefits.
Speaking about the new agreement, Stephan Lutz, CEO & Group CFO of BitMEX, said:
“We are thrilled to reinforce our partnership with AC Milan. Beyond the philanthropic projects we have worked on together, we both appreciate and applaud the spirit of competition and the sense of connection that comes from it. At BitMEX, we strive to include connection and competition in the services and products we offer – our new social trading feature Guilds allows traders to team up as a Guild and trade against one another.”
The BitMEX logo appeared on an AC Milan jersey for the first time when their men’s team took on Genoa in a Serie A clash during the 2021/22 season. This, however, won’t be the case this time as MSC Cruises has since taken over as the sleeve partner of the club.
